Young finishes sixth in Commonwealth Games 50m Freestyle Final
[Image: Team Fiji]

Team Fiji swimmer David Tolu Young produced a stellar performance in the men's 50 metres freestyle final, finishing sixth with a time of 22.18 seconds at the 2026 Glasgow Commonwealth Games.

The 21-year-old created history by becoming the first Fijian swimmer to reach a Commonwealth Games final.


Australia's Cameron McEvoy, Flynn Southam and Jamie Jack finished first, second and third respectively.

Young will compete in tonight's men's 100 metres freestyle heats, which begin at 10.09pm.

Other Team Fiji swimmers competing in the men's 100 metres freestyle heats are Hansel McCaig and Reuben Taylor.

18-year-old Kelera Mudunasoko will compete in the women's 50 metres breaststroke heats at 10.34pm.

Meanwhile, Anahira McCutcheon finished sixth in the women's 100 metres freestyle semi-finals with a time of 55.80 seconds, while Samuel Yalimaiwai finished eighth in the men's 50 metres breaststroke semi-finals.
